孚能科技固态电池取得突破:人形机器人电池送样,公布二代产品量产规划

Group 1 - Company has launched the first generation of sulfide all-solid-state batteries for humanoid robots, completing sample delivery to leading humanoid robot companies and progressing well in demand alignment with multiple industry leaders [1] - The sulfide all-solid-state battery has achieved key breakthroughs, specifically tailored for humanoid robot clients' needs for high safety, lightweight, and long endurance, differentiating itself from electric vehicle power batteries [1] - The battery features a high nickel ternary cathode and high silicon anode combination, achieving an energy density of 400Wh/kg, which meets the stringent requirements for high energy density, lightweight, and safety in humanoid robots [1] Group 2 - The company announced plans for the second generation of all-solid-state batteries, set to launch in 2026, with an upgraded energy density of over 500Wh/kg, a 25% increase from the first generation [2] - The second generation will utilize advanced sulfide electrolyte systems, demonstrating high ionic conductivity and a wide operating temperature range, with safety features that include thermal runaway self-shutdown capabilities [2] - Production plans include a pilot line for small-scale delivery of 60Ah products by the end of 2025, vehicle validation from 2026 to 2027, and large-scale production by 2030 [2] Group 3 - The humanoid robot industry is approaching mass production, with industry forecasts predicting global battery demand for robots to reach 100GWh by 2030 [3]
